Vacancies & reservation
What is known, what overlaps and what remains unreported.
Category table not available here
Check the latest official notice for the post- and category-wise distribution.
How to read reservation: UR, EWS, OBC, SC and ST are vertical categories. PwBD, women, ex-servicemen and similar horizontal reservations can overlap them and must not be added again to the total.

Who can apply?
A readable first check—not a legal eligibility decision.
Basic eligibility paths
- The Board is constituted under the West Bengal Primary Education Act 1973 and regulates primary teacher eligibility and recruitment in the state.
- Confirm education, D.El.Ed. or equivalent training, age and category rules from the Board's official TET notification for the cycle you are applying to; nothing about a current cycle is asserted here.
- Qualifying the TET is an eligibility step; appointment follows a separate recruitment notification for Assistant Teachers in primary schools, which the Board issues on the same notice list.

Selection process & syllabus
Stage by stage, without mixing recruitment years.
Selection stages
- 1A single Teacher Eligibility Test for Classes I to V (Primary) — the stage sequence recorded on the Board's dated notice list for TET-2023 was notification, online application (with a reopening and an edit option), admit card, examination, provisional answer keys with argumentation through the OCMS portal, final answer keys and result.
- 2The Board issues a TET eligibility certificate to qualified candidates; its notice list carries separate notifications on issuing TET-2014, TET-2017 and TET-2022 eligibility certificates.
- 3No selection stage for a current general primary TET cycle is asserted here.
Syllabus snapshot
- The Board does not publish a standalone syllabus PDF for the primary TET; for TET-2023 it published a circular titled 'Relevant Information and Part-wise Model Questions for Teacher Eligibility Test-2023 (TET-2023) (For Primary)' on 16 Oct 2023 with an addendum circular on 18 Oct 2023.
- It followed the same practice for the February 2026 Special Education Teacher TET, publishing 'Relevant Information and Part-wise Model Questions' on 9 Feb 2026.
- Use the circular the Board publishes for the cycle you are applying to; no current-cycle syllabus is asserted here.
